Sandbanks is a small peninsula located on the eastern edge of Poole Harbour, known for its sandy beaches and vibrant marine environment. It forms part of the town of Poole and lies close to the popular seaside resort of Bournemouth. The area is renowned for its scenic views over the harbour and its proximity to the Isle of Purbeck, which features landmarks such as Old Harry Rocks and the Jurassic Coast.

Famed for its award-winning Blue Flag beach, Sandbanks is a haven for sunbathing, swimming and family beach games. The calm, shallow waters are perfect for children, while those seeking adventure can try paddleboarding, windsurfing, sailing or kayaking. Just steps away, Poole Harbour is one of the world’s largest natural harbours and a hotspot for boating and fishing.
For walkers, the South West Coast Path runs close by, leading you towards Studland Bay and the iconic Old Harry Rocks. You can also take the Sandbanks chain ferry across to the Isle of Purbeck, opening up the Jurassic Coast and its spectacular cliffs, coves and countryside. Golf courses, cycling routes and day trips to Bournemouth, Poole and the New Forest all add to the variety of things to do.
